Types of electric bicycle batteries:

Some types of electric bicycle batteries are underneath:

Nickel-cadmium (Ni-Cd) batteries:

Nickel-cadmium batteries have high power and efficiency. But these batteries are not considered good batteries when purchased. The most common reason is that they have a short life span. On the other hand, because of their high cost and the fact that they are hard to reuse. They are rapidly losing their relevance as a technology. Nickel-cadmium electric bicycle batteries are pricey and harmful to the environment. They also play a vital role in completing approximately 2000-25000 cycles.

Sealed lead-acid:

Since these batteries have been there for a century, the technology behind them has likely seen significant development.

On a positive note, they are the most cost-effective option available, and we can also recycle these electric bicycle batteries. People who think of designing their customized bicycles on a restricted budget will find this an excellent resource. On the other hand, they are bulky, wouldn't last for a long time, have a lower capacity, and are more susceptible to the effects of shifting weather patterns than their competitors. Depending on the production method, sealed lead-acid batteries may last from three to five years to more than a decade.

Lithium-ion batteries:

Lithium batteries have held the largest market share for several factors. They're smaller, but they pack a bigger punch. To avoid self-destruction and instant burn, they need the most secure protocols. There is no need to be concerned since the newest technology and elevated manufacturers have taken care of those safety concerns. Although lithium electric bicycle batteries are more costly, they have a significantly longer lifetime than alkaline batteries. If the battery is correctly cared for, you may expect it to last around three and five years.  

Nickel-metal hydride (NiMh) batteries:

These sorts of batteries are more expensive than those made with nickel-cadmium because they have a high energy density.  Due to lithium's increasing popularity over the last several years, these batteries, despite their high cost, are quickly becoming a thing of the past. These batteries are more cost-effective while also providing high results. These electric bicycle batteries have a longer lifespan and are simpler to recover.

When shopping for an electric bicycle, it is crucial to know the following:

  • Panasonic, LG, and Samsung have a strong reputation in the battery market for producing high-quality cells, which is why it is justified to pay a higher price for these cells. If the electric bicycle you are considering purchasing does not have or give guidance on the cell manufacturer, it is unlikely that you will find them to be a trusted source.
  • When it comes to cell chemistry, lithium-ion (also known as li-ion) batteries are your best choice for electric bicycles. The weight of lead-acid batteries is almost three times that of their li-ion competitors, although they are substantially more affordable. Your battery's lifespan might be affected by the amount of specific energy it stores.
  • Specific power measures how well a battery can withstand high load situations, such as climbing a steep hill.

What kind of maintenance should I provide for electric bicycle batteries?

After every ride, you may get into certain good habits that will not only prolong the life of your battery but also keep it in peak condition so that it is always ready for the next journey. These good habits will enhance the battery's lifetime. It is comparable to the batteries used in other gadgets, such as laptops and mobile phones.

Let's have a look at how to care for electric bicycle batteries:

The very first thing you need to do is secure the batteries to the frames using the clip as best you can. It is necessary to completely secure the battery from being dislodged while riding and ensure it continues to work correctly. Before washing your e-bike, you should always disconnect the battery and take it out of the bike. It will prevent the battery from being damaged and will extend its lifetime.
